Nora Springs-area historical tornado activity is near Iowa state average. It is 113%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/15/1968, a category 5 (max. wind speeds 261-318 mph) tornado 27.0 miles away from the Nora Springs city center killed 13 people and injured 462 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.

On 4/30/1967, a category 4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 15.5 miles away from the city center caused between $50,000 and $500,000 in damages.
